What is BPC 157?
BPC 157 is a synthetic peptide derived from a protein found in the stomach. It is known for its regenerative effects on tissues, including muscles, tendons, ligaments, and the gut lining. Researchers have studied BPC 157 for its ability to promote healing and reduce inflammation in various injury models.
The peptide works by supporting angiogenesis, the formation of new blood vessels, and modulating growth factors that accelerate tissue repair. These properties make it a promising candidate for recovery from injuries and chronic conditions.
How Does Oral BPC 157 Work?
Unlike many peptides that break down in the digestive system, BPC 157 shows remarkable stability when taken orally. This means it can survive stomach acids and enzymes, allowing it to be absorbed into the bloodstream and reach target tissues.
Once absorbed, oral BPC 157 interacts with cells to:
Stimulate blood vessel growth
Reduce inflammation
Enhance collagen production
Protect the gut lining
These actions contribute to faster healing and improved tissue health.
Safety of Oral BPC 157
Safety is a top concern when considering any supplement or peptide therapy. Based on current research and anecdotal reports, oral BPC 157 appears to have a strong safety profile.
Low toxicity: Animal studies have shown no significant toxic effects even at high doses.
Minimal side effects: Users report few adverse reactions, mostly mild and temporary such as slight digestive discomfort.
Non-immunogenic: BPC 157 does not trigger immune responses that could cause allergies or rejection.
Despite these positive indicators, it is important to remember that human clinical trials are limited. Anyone considering oral BPC 157 should consult a healthcare professional, especially if pregnant, nursing, or managing chronic health conditions.
Benefits of Taking BPC 157 Orally
Oral administration offers several advantages beyond convenience. Here are some key benefits supported by research and user experience:
1. Accelerated Healing of Injuries
BPC 157 promotes repair of muscles, tendons, and ligaments. Studies in animals show faster recovery from tendon tears and muscle strains. Oral use allows continuous support for healing without the discomfort of injections.
2. Gut Health Support
Because BPC 157 originates from a stomach protein, it has a natural affinity for the digestive system. It helps protect and repair the gut lining, which can benefit people with inflammatory bowel diseases, ulcers, or leaky gut syndrome.
3. Reduced Inflammation
Chronic inflammation contributes to many health problems. BPC 157 helps regulate inflammatory responses, potentially easing symptoms in conditions like arthritis or inflammatory bowel disease.
4. Neuroprotective Effects
Emerging research suggests BPC 157 may support brain health by protecting neurons and improving recovery after brain injuries. Oral delivery could provide a practical way to access these benefits.
5. Improved Blood Flow
By encouraging new blood vessel formation, BPC 157 enhances circulation to damaged tissues. Better blood flow means more oxygen and nutrients reach the injury site, speeding up repair.

What the Research Says
While human studies are limited, animal research provides valuable insights. For example, one study found that rats with tendon injuries healed faster when given BPC 157 orally compared to controls. Another study showed improved gut lining repair in animals with induced ulcers.
Human anecdotal reports also highlight benefits such as reduced joint pain, faster recovery from workouts, and improved digestive comfort. These findings suggest oral BPC 157 holds promise, but more clinical trials are needed to confirm optimal dosing and long-term safety.
